
Domain transfer — the process of moving a domain name registration from one registrar to another — is a standard operation governed by ICANN (Internet Corporation for Assigned Names and Numbers) policies. Domain owners transfer domains for various legitimate reasons including better pricing at another registrar, superior management features, consolidating domains under a single registrar, dissatisfaction with current registrar support or interface, or taking advantage of specific features offered by alternative registrars. Understanding the transfer process, requirements, timing, and potential complications ensures smooth and seamless domain transitions without any service disruption.
This guide provides comprehensive coverage of the domain transfer process, explaining ICANN transfer policies, step-by-step transfer procedures, DNS management during transfers, common issues and solutions, and best practices for ensuring successful domain migrations. The information applies to standard gTLD transfers (.com, .net, .org, etc.) with notes on country-code TLD variations where applicable.
ICANN Transfer Policy Overview
ICANN’s Inter-Registrar Transfer Policy (IRTP) establishes the rules governing domain transfers between accredited registrars. Key policy provisions include: transfers must be initiated by the domain registrant or authorized administrative contact; the gaining registrar (receiving the domain) initiates the transfer process; the losing registrar (the current registrar) must not unreasonably refuse a valid transfer request; a valid authorization code (EPP code/auth code) is required; and transfers include one year of registration renewal at the gaining registrar’s transfer price.
the IRTP also establishes important transfer restrictions: domains cannot be transferred within 60 days of initial registration; domains cannot be transferred within 60 days of a previous transfer; and the losing registrar may apply a 60-day transfer lock following a change of registrant (WHOIS contact change). These important restrictions prevent fraudulent transfers and ensure that domain ownership changes follow orderly procedures.
Pre-Transfer Preparation
Before initiating a domain transfer, several important preparation steps are essential for a smooth process. First, verify that the domain is eligible for transfer by confirming it was registered more than 60 days ago, has not been transferred within the last 60 days, and has not had a recent registrant change that triggered a transfer lock. Second, check that the domain’s administrative contact email address is current and accessible, as transfer authorization emails are sent to this address.
Third, ensure that the domain’s WHOIS information is accurate and accessible — if WHOIS privacy is enabled, determine whether the privacy service forwards transfer authorization emails or whether privacy needs to be temporarily disabled during the transfer. Fourth, verify that the domain’s registration is not expired, as expired domains may not be eligible for transfer through the standard ICANN process. Fifth, confirm that no pending disputes, legal holds, or registrar-imposed restrictions prevent the transfer.

Step-by-Step Transfer Process
Step 1: Unlock the Domain
Most registrars apply a domain lock (registrar lock) by default to prevent unauthorized transfers. The domain must be unlocked through the current registrar’s management interface before a transfer can proceed. The unlock process typically involves navigating to the domain’s settings page and toggling the lock status from locked to unlocked.
Step 2: Obtain the Authorization Code
The authorization code (also called EPP code, auth code, or transfer key) is a unique security code assigned to each domain that must be provided to the gaining registrar to authorize the transfer. The authorization code is obtained from the current registrar, typically through the domain management interface, account settings, or by contacting customer support. Some registrars display the code directly in the interface, while others email it to the administrative contact.
Step 3: Initiate Transfer at the Gaining Registrar
At the new registrar where the domain is being transferred to, initiate the transfer process by entering the domain name and the authorization code. The gaining registrar will verify the authorization code and initiate the transfer request with the domain registry. Payment for the transfer (which includes one year of registration renewal) is typically required at this initial stage.
Step 4: Confirm the Transfer
An authorization email is sent to the domain’s administrative contact email address requesting explicit confirmation of the transfer. This email typically contains a link that must be clicked to approve the transfer. If the transfer is not explicitly approved, it will proceed automatically after approximately 5 days. Some registrars also send a notification to the losing registrar’s administrative interface or account email.
Step 5: Wait for Processing
After authorization, the transfer typically takes 5-7 days to complete. During this processing period, the domain continues to function normally and serve visitors with existing DNS settings. The losing registrar has a window to object to the transfer (though registrar objections are only valid for specific ICANN policy reasons). Once the transfer completes, the domain appears in the gaining registrar’s account for management.
DNS Management During Transfer
Understanding DNS behavior during transfers is critical for preventing website downtime. During a standard registrar transfer, DNS settings typically remain unchanged — the domain continues resolving to the same IP addresses and services throughout the transfer process. However, the DNS management interface transitions from the losing registrar to the gaining registrar upon transfer completion.
Best practice for DNS during transfer: before initiating the transfer, document all current DNS records (A, CNAME, MX, TXT, NS records) by taking screenshots or exporting the DNS configuration from the current registrar. After the transfer completes, verify that all DNS records are correctly configured at the gaining registrar. If using the registrar’s DNS hosting (rather than external DNS like Cloudflare), DNS records may need to be recreated at the new registrar.
For zero-downtime transfers, consider pointing the domain to an external DNS provider (such as Cloudflare’s free DNS) before initiating the transfer. Since external DNS operates independently of the registrar, changing registrars does not affect DNS resolution. After the transfer completes, the domain continues using the external DNS service regardless of which registrar manages the underlying registration.
Email Service Considerations
Email services associated with the domain require careful attention during transfers. If email hosting is provided by the current registrar (through the registrar’s email service), transferring the domain may affect email delivery. MX records that point to the current registrar’s email servers must be updated if the new registrar does not automatically replicate these settings.
For email hosted through third-party providers (Google Workspace, Microsoft 365, external email hosts), the registrar transfer typically does not affect email service delivery as long as MX records remain correctly configured. Verifying MX record configuration after transfer completion ensures uninterrupted email delivery.
Common Transfer Issues
Authorization Code Not Working
Authorization codes can fail if they have expired (some registrars set expiration periods), if they contain whitespace or special characters that are not correctly copied, or if the code has been regenerated after the initial code was provided. Regenerating a fresh authorization code from the current registrar’s management interface typically resolves this issue.
Transfer Rejected by Losing Registrar
Losing registrars may reject transfers for valid reasons including: the domain is within the 60-day post-registration lock period; the domain is within the 60-day post-transfer lock period; a transfer lock was applied after a recent registrant change; the domain has a pending legal dispute; or there are outstanding payment obligations on the account. Contacting the losing registrar’s support team to identify the specific rejection reason enables addressing the issue.
Administrative Contact Email Issues
If the administrative contact email is no longer accessible, transfer authorization cannot be confirmed through email. Updating the administrative contact email before initiating the transfer resolves this issue, though note that updating the registrant contact may trigger a new 60-day transfer lock at some registrars.
WHOIS Privacy Interference
Some WHOIS privacy services substitute the registrant’s email with a privacy service address that may not properly forward transfer authorization emails. Temporarily disabling WHOIS privacy before initiating the transfer ensures that authorization emails reach the actual domain owner. WHOIS privacy can be re-enabled at the gaining registrar after transfer completion.
Transfer Timing Considerations
Optimal transfer timing considers several important factors: avoid transferring domains close to their expiration date, as expired domains may not be transferable through the standard process; plan transfers during low-traffic business periods to minimize impact of any potential DNS issues; allow sufficient time for the 5-7 day transfer processing window; and consider that the transfer includes one year of renewal, so timing transfers near the existing expiration date maximizes the value of the included renewal year.
Bulk Domain Transfers
For portfolio owners transferring multiple domains between registrars, many registrars provide bulk transfer tools that streamline the multi-domain transfer process. Bulk transfers enable submitting multiple domain names and authorization codes simultaneously, processing all transfers as a batch rather than individual operations. Bulk transfer pricing may include attractive volume discounts at some registrars.
Country-Code TLD Transfer Variations
Country-code TLD (.co.uk, .de, .ca, .au) transfers may follow different procedures than generic TLD transfers. Some country-code registries have their own transfer policies that differ from ICANN’s IRTP. For example, .uk transfers use a tag-change system rather than authorization codes, .de transfers may require additional verification, and some country-code TLDs have different lock periods or authorization requirements. When transferring country-code domains, consult both the losing and gaining registrars for specific procedural requirements.
Cost Analysis of Domain Transfers
Domain transfers include one year of registration renewal at the gaining registrar’s transfer price. This renewal year is added to the domain’s existing expiration date, meaning that no registration time is lost during the transfer. The effective cost of the transfer is the difference between the gaining registrar’s transfer price and what would have been paid to renew at the current registrar. If the gaining registrar’s transfer and renewal price is lower than the current registrar’s renewal price, the transfer itself generates savings. For domain portfolio owners managing multiple domains, cumulative savings from transferring to a lower-cost registrar can be very significant over time.
SSL Certificate Considerations
SSL certificates are independent of domain registrar — they are issued by Certificate Authorities and configured on the hosting server. Transferring a domain registration between registrars does not affect existing SSL certificates. However, if the current registrar provides SSL certificates as part of their service (some registrars include free SSL), the SSL certificate may not transfer with the domain. For standard hosting configurations using Let’s Encrypt or Cloudflare’s free SSL, registrar transfers have no impact on SSL certificate status. Verify SSL certificate functionality after transfer completion to ensure HTTPS continues operating correctly.
Downtime Prevention Strategies
Zero-downtime domain transfers are achievable with proper planning. The most effective strategy involves using a third-party DNS provider (Cloudflare, Route 53, Google Cloud DNS) as an intermediary. Before initiating the transfer, point the domain’s nameservers to the third-party DNS provider and configure all DNS records there. Since the DNS service operates independently of the registrar, the registrar transfer does not affect DNS resolution. After the transfer completes, the domain continues using the third-party DNS provider seamlessly, with the new registrar managing only the registration rather than DNS.
Transfer Dispute Resolution
ICANN provides formal dispute resolution mechanisms for contested domain transfers. The Transfer Dispute Resolution Policy (TDRP) enables registrars and registrants to challenge transfers that occurred improperly. If a domain is transferred without the registrant’s authorization, the registrant can file a complaint with ICANN or initiate a dispute through the losing registrar. ICANN’s TDRP process can reverse unauthorized transfers and restore domain registration to the legitimate registrant. The dispute process typically requires evidence of unauthorized transfer, including comprehensive documentation of the domain’s legitimate ownership and the circumstances of the disputed transfer.
GDPR Impact on Transfers
GDPR (General Data Protection Regulation) has affected the domain transfer process by restricting access to WHOIS registration data. Under GDPR, registrant contact information may be redacted in WHOIS records, which can complicate the transfer verification process. However, registrars are required to maintain contact mechanisms for legitimate transfer operations. The transfer authorization process works through established registrar-to-registrant communication channels regardless of WHOIS data availability, ensuring that GDPR compliance does not prevent legitimate domain transfers.
Registrar-Specific Transfer Guides
Each registrar has specific interface locations and procedures for unlocking domains and obtaining authorization codes. For GoDaddy, the authorization code and domain lock settings are accessed through the Domain Settings page. For Namecheap, the Authorization Code and Domain Lock are available in the Domain List management area. For Cloudflare Registrar, transfer settings are managed through the domain’s Overview page in the Cloudflare dashboard. For registrar-specific transfer procedures, consulting the current registrar’s official knowledge base documentation or contacting their customer support team directly provides the most accurate and up-to-date procedural guidance.
Automated Transfer Monitoring
Some registrars provide automated transfer monitoring features that alert domain owners to incoming transfer requests, enabling prompt and informed approval or rejection of transfer attempts. These important notifications serve as a critical security measure, alerting owners to unauthorized transfer attempts. Enabling email notifications for domain-related activities and regularly monitoring registrar communications ensures that domain owners remain aware of any transfer activity affecting their domains.
Hidden Fees and Transfer Cost Transparency
Reputable registrars charge a single, clearly stated transfer fee that includes one year of domain renewal. Domain owners should verify that no additional hidden fees are applied during the transfer process, including processing fees, administration fees, or service activation charges. Some registrars offer transfer-in promotions with discounted transfer pricing, which provides additional savings when migrating domains. The transfer price should be confirmed before initiating the transfer to avoid unexpected charges during the process.
Post-Transfer Checklist
After a domain transfer completes, verify the following: all DNS records are correctly configured and the website is accessible; MX records are correct and email is functioning; WHOIS privacy is enabled if desired; auto-renewal is configured to prevent accidental expiration; domain lock is re-enabled to prevent unauthorized transfers; and all administrative contact information is current. This post-transfer verification ensures that the domain is fully functional and properly secured at the new registrar.
Transfer vs Nameserver Change
Domain transfer and nameserver change are different operations that are sometimes confused. A domain transfer moves the domain registration between registrars — changing who manages the domain registration, renewal, and administrative settings. A nameserver change simply points the domain’s DNS to a different DNS provider without changing the registrar — the domain remains registered at the same registrar but DNS is managed elsewhere. Users who are satisfied with their current registrar but want better DNS management (Cloudflare’s DNS, for example) only need a nameserver change, not a full domain transfer.
Summary
Domain transfer is a well-defined and standardized process governed by established ICANN policies that enables domain owners to move their registrations between registrars. Successful transfers require proper preparation (unlocking the domain, obtaining authorization codes, verifying contact information), understanding DNS implications, and following the standard well-defined 5-step process. By documenting DNS configurations, planning transfer timing, and completing the post-transfer verification checklist, domain owners can ensure seamless transitions between registrars without website downtime or service disruption.
Information discussed in this guide reflects standard ICANN transfer policies and common registrar practices. Specific procedures may vary by registrar and TLD. Please verify current procedures with your specific registrar. Okut Hosting is an independent review platform with no affiliate relationships with any company mentioned in this article.
For related guides, see our GoDaddy vs Namecheap comparison, our DNS management basics, and our domain lock settings guide.





